Borno Attorney-general Links Sheriff To Boko Haram; Calls For Ex-governor’s Arrest

Source: thewillnigeria.com

SAN FRANCISCO, August 24, (THEWILL) – The Borno state Attorney-General and Commissioner of Justice, Hon Kaka Shehu Lawan has called for the arrest and prosecution of a former governor of the state, Alhaji Ali Modu Sheriff, accusing him of masterminding the growth of the dreaded Boko Haram terrorist sect.

Speaking on Tuesday at one of the sessions at the ongoing annual conference of the Nigerian Bar Association, NBA, in Port Harcourt, Rivers state, Lawan claimed that Sheriff, who is a factional national chairman of the Peoples Democratic Party, PDP, encouraged spread of the Islamic terrorist sect.

He maintained that the arrest of Sheriff over his alleged role in the emergence of Boko Haram will assuage the feelings of millions that have been dislocated by the deadly activities of Boko Haram terrorists in one way or the other.
